Towing

elknutz, 11/30/2008
2008 Toyota Sequoia Limited 4dr SUV (5.7L 8cyl 6A)
1 of 1 people found this review helpful

We all know how the Sequoia drives under normal conditions, but hook up a travel trailer and enjoy it even more. Our fully loaded Limited includes the air bag suspension which keeps the vehicle level without having to transfer additional weight to the front end. After a weekend outing to the Oregon Coast I was very impressed with the power this rig has. The combo with our 29' Tango was no match for climbing or descending the Oregon Coast Range. The transmission shifted with ease while in the tow mode and is simply a workhorse. The Sequoia handled better than any other truck / trailer combo I have driven over the last 15 years.

Excellent Choice

Schnauzer, 12/01/2008
2008 Toyota Sequoia Limited 4dr SUV 4WD (5.7L 8cyl 6A)
1 of 1 people found this review helpful

With a need to haul people and tow a boat, big SUVs are my family's only option. I have spent a lot of time in all the competing big SUVs. With the changes brought to the Sequoia in 2008, I now feel it is the best vehicle in its class. Love the fold flat third row, and the ride and handling are as close to 'sportscar' as you can get in a big vehicle like this. The 'wish list' includes some gps/computer oddities but the engine/ride/handling/utility are unrivaled. The bluetooth/audio/temp controls on the steering wheel are excellent and totally negate the need to reach for the main controls strewn across the dash. Some gps/phone features are unavailable while driving in the name of safety

Good Truck, It runs like a car

stopshop01, 12/08/2008
2008 Toyota Sequoia SR5 4dr SUV 4WD (5.7L 8cyl 6A)
1 of 1 people found this review helpful

It is the first truck we own. Drive very comfortable and good mileage. We took 2 trips to the same road to test out the mileage. First trip fill up with Sheetz gas and got 17.8 mpg avg. Second trip fill up with Sunoco gas and got 18.4 mpg avg on the computer display. Wonder why so much different? It must be the quality in brand gas and no brand. Over all, it is very good truck and highly recommend to new buyer.
